Death of Alice Edith Blanch CARTER, The Times, 2nd January 1945
Deaths, The Times, Tuesday, Jan 02, 1945; pg. 1; Issue 50030; col B |
CARTER - On Jan. 1st, 1945, at Drinkstone, Douglas Avenue, Exmouth, ALICE EDITH BLANCH CARTER, widow of Walter Thomas Carter, late of “Chulsaâ€, Sydenham, aged 78. No flowers at her request. |
